Ventura Adult and Continuing Education vs.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a
Both Ventura Adult and Continuing Education and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a are Less than 2 years schools located in California. The following statements compare Ventura Adult and Continuing Education and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a's tuition ($14,115) is more expensive than Ventura Adult and Continuing Education ($8,370).
- Ventura Adult and Continuing Education's students to faculty ratio (2 to 1) is lower than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a (12 to 1).
-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a (347 students) is larger than Ventura Adult and Continuing Education (52 students) with more enrolled students.
-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a ($4,445) has higher amount of financial aid than Ventura Adult and Continuing Education ($3,642).
- Ventura Adult and Continuing Education's graduation rate (97%) is higher than Paul Mitchell the School-Costa Mesa (86%).
